JavaScript作为一种高级编程语言,现在已经成为了 Web 应用程序开发的主流语言之一。它不仅仅可以在浏览器中运行,而且可以在服务器端运行。JavaScript具有非常强大的功能,可以让程序员们开发出高效、交互性强的应用程序。

JavaScript最大的优势就是它可以与 HTML 和 CSS 无缝集成,可以非常方便地操作 HTML 元素,实现各种动态效果。通过 JavaScript,我们可以轻松地实现页面的各种交互效果,比如鼠标悬停事件、按钮点击事件、页面滚动事件等等。

除此之外,JavaScript还有许多其他的功能,比如可以进行表单验证、创建动画、处理日期和时间、实现图像滚动、音频视频播放等等。JavaScript的强大功能使得它在许多 Web 应用程序开发中占有重要地位。

与此同时,JavaScript的语法也非常简单易懂,即使没有编程经验的人也可以很快地掌握。JavaScript的代码可以直接在浏览器中执行,非常方便调试,对于入门级的程序员而言,这也是一个很大的优势。

尽管JavaScript有着这些优点,但是它也有一些缺点。首先,JavaScript代码的可读性较差,由于其灵活性和动态性,可能会让代码难以理解。此外,JavaScript代码的性能也可能受到影响,因为它需要在运行时进行解释和编译。

总的来说,JavaScript是一种非常强大的编程语言,它在 Web 应用程序开发中具有重要地位。JavaScript的语法简单易懂,功能丰富,可以非常方便地操作 HTML 元素。尽管它也有一些缺点,但是这些缺点并不能掩盖其在 Web 开发中的优越性能。